No skipping certificates validation when log forwarding in RHOCP 4
Issue
-
When defined
tls.insecureSkipVerify: true
to log forward skipping the validation of the certificates, it fails with the error:2023-03-14T13:50:39.948175007Z 2023-03-14 13:50:39 +0000 [warn]: [remote_elasticsearch] failed to flush the buffer. retry_times=37 next_retry_time=2023-03-14 13:51:34 +0000 chunk="5f6dadf25a0153c6bb1053cbbe0849c4" error_class=Fluent::Plugin::ElasticsearchOutput::RecoverableRequestFailure error="could not push logs to Elasticsearch cluster ({:host=>\"x.x.x.x\", :port=>9200, :scheme=>\"https\", :user=>\"username\", :password=>\"obfuscated\"}): Peer certificate cannot be authenticated with given CA certificates"
Environment
- Red Hat OpenShift Container Platform (RHOCP)
- 4
- Red Hat OpenShift Logging (RHOL)
- 5.5
- 5.6
- 5.7
- 5.8
- Fluentd
- Vector
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.